Romantic and Modern Ages are well known for the dominance of poetry. A comparative study with critical approach of the poetry composed during both the ages. It is difficult to pinpoint the exact start of the romantic movement, as its beginning can be traced to many events of the time: a surge of interest in folklore in the early to mid-nineteenth century with the work of the brothers Grimm, reactions against neoclassicism and the Augustan poets in England, and political events and uprisings that fostered nationalistic pride.
